Crews have extinguished a three-alarm blaze at the Shamrock Hotel Tuesday morning.
Lee was in a suite at the Ramsay landmark when the fire broke out.
“I just heard the alarm go off, and then I opened the door and there’s all this smoke,” Lee says, “I shut the door and I was trying to break the window but I had to wait for these fire trucks to come in and break it for us.”
To help the fire department get a handle on the situation, 11th St. is closed from 9th Ave. all the way to 25th Ave., and 21 Ave. is closed from 11 St. to 9 St.
Fire Chief Bruce Burrell is on the scene and is promising an update on the fire shortly.
The Shamrock is a Calgary landmark, and it appears the bar will reopen once repairs are made.
